Tom Jued Soup (Thai Vegetable Soup)
This healthy tom jued soup with vegetables and glass noodles is light, easy to make, and naturally low in calories.

- Prep time
- 15 min
- Cook time
- 15 min
- Yield
- 6 servings
- Difficulty
- MEDIUM
Ingredients
Quantities are shown as originally provided.
- 3 cloves garlic (peeled)
- 3 cilantro root
- 1 tablespoon black peppercorns
- 3 bouillon cubes
- 2 tablespoons oyster sauce (see notes)
- 1 1/2 cups carrot (sliced)
- 1/3 cup celery (sliced)
- dried shiitake mushrooms (add to taste)
- 3 cups Chinese cabbage (sliced)
- 2 tubes egg tofu (sliced)
- 2 oz dry glass noodles
Instructions
- 1
Soak glass noodles (and dried shiitake mushrooms) in water according to package instructions.
- 2
Pound garlic, coriander root, and black peppercorns with a mortar and pestle.
- 3
Place a pot filled with water over medium heat. Add the pounded mixture from step 2, bouillon cubes, and oyster sauce. Close the lid and bring back to a boil.
- 4
Add carrots, celery, and dried shiitake mushrooms. Let boil for 2 minutes.
- 5
Add the softer vegetables (Chinese cabbage), the egg tofu, and the glass noodles. Cook for 1 more minute and remove from heat. Serve immediately.
